Trying to figure out if I have the correct DG water pump and Crank pulleys on my 70 L78 Nova. I understand that Chevy switched P/N's and or DG pulleys mid year on the SHP BB Nova's. My build date is the 2nd week of May 1970, I have been told they are supposed to have the same pulleys as the LS6, if the car was a late 70 car. Any help would be appreciated. Thanks SULLY

Sully
For your May 1970 Nova L78,you should have
DG Water Pump Pulley#3976060AP.Look in box 22 for the AP suffix.
Your DG Crank Pulley should be Part#3955291AB,and 2 grooved is the only way it came.Look in box 35 for the AB suffix.The 1970 L78/LS6 production cars shared these as well.
DG Fan Pulley#3995647AP was a 1971 Over the counter pulley.It will work,but not assembly line correct.
